Truphone wins court injunction against T-Mobile blocking tactics T-Mobile is notorious for not only blocking Truephone, but also blocking VoIP and third-party text messaging as well. Well, today a judge has instructed T-Mobile (UK) to stop blocking calls to Truphone. The judge granted a mandatory ... | ||

VoIP Provider SunRocket Suddenly Closes (The Herald-Sun) Internet phone service provider SunRocket, which had as many as 200,000 customers nationwide, has ceased operations without warning. The move by SunRocket, which offered service via Voice over Internet Protocol, or VoIP, was first reported Monday on The New York Times' Web site... | ||
